Match Summary

Lankan Lions and Bucharest Gladiators met in Match 22 of ECS T10 Romania, and the contest unfolded as a tactical battle rather than a straightforward run chase. Bucharest Gladiators posted 149/2 (10). Lankan Lions posted 89/8 (10). Amir Hamza led the batting charts with 79 from 30 balls, blending risk control with timely acceleration. Waqas Ahmed-II delivered the standout spell, finishing with 2 wickets while conceding only 5 runs.
